Title: Draft Minutes for the Elizabeth Dean Fund Committee - April 14th, 2026 - Version 2
Summary
The Elizabeth Dean Fund Committee of the City of Ann Arbor met on April 14, 2026, to discuss strategies for increasing tree plantings while managing maintenance costs and equity in planting efforts. The committee emphasized the need for responsible spending and the importance of native groundcovers. Key discussions included upcoming projects requiring investment, like tree treatments for Dutch elm disease, and the approval process for larger planting initiatives. The meeting also addressed ongoing and future projects, such as Arbor Day activities and updates on various park projects. Public participation was encouraged, with provisions for accommodations.
